Handover Note — Director Transition, Property Matters

From: D. Varga. To: L. Okonde.

Status on the Fenwick Row lease: two rounds complete with Aldercrest Estates. Open items: break clause timing, service charge cap, signage rights. Our walk-away position is a 5% uplift; current offer sits at 7%. Branch managers should hold expansion requests until terms close. All correspondence is in the shared file. Read the note below before your first session.

board note of bajof-tawif: Kasaelek Group plans to raise the Julok list price by 55.7 percent in April. The board signed off on a budget of $459.1 million for Project Silir. The renewal with Briaxix Holdings closes at $113.0 million a year, 50.8 percent above the last contract. Project Eliiel slips by two quarters because of the supplier delay.

Subject: Eastmark Sales Review — quick recap for finance

Hi all,

Quick summary from yesterday's Eastmark regional review. Numbers came in a touch soft — down 3% overall, though the Corvell line is still carrying us. Dana Frith is reworking the rep incentive structure, and we'll need finance's read on the cost impact before month-end. Nothing alarming, but worth a close look at the margin detail. The confidential note on upcoming business plans is pasted just below.

board note of kageg-bahof: The renewal with Holwynax Holdings closes at $2 million a year, 5 percent below the last contract. Project Ulaath slips by two quarters because of the supplier delay.

## Tuning

After the great stale-cache incident of last spring (ask anyone on the Marrowdeck team, they'll sigh), we stopped trusting the defaults. The bug: entries outlived their TTL because the sweeper only ran when traffic was high, so quiet weekends served week-old prices. We now sweep on a fixed timer and cap entry age hard, no exceptions. If you're tempted to bump these numbers, read the postmortem first — every value was argued over at length. The current constants are listed below.

tuning table, kajog-kawef:
PRIORITIES = {
    "kelox": 870,
    "kasix": 89,
    "eliax": 988,
}